Are you ready to take your Quince guests to a Long Beach banquet hall destination that has a combination of sand, surf, and city nightlife? The city of Long Beach, which is less than 30 miles south from downtown Los Angeles, boasts miles of coastline with a lively background of restaurants and venues that can be a great host for your upcoming Quince celebration.

1) Utopia Restaurant

Tucked away near Long Beach’s East Village Arts District, this California-cuisine restaurant is the perfect Long Beach banquet hall if you are looking for a cozy atmosphere to host an intimate gathering for a small number of family and friends. Artwork hangs along the exposed brick walls, making Utopia an inviting atmosphere for any Picasso-inspired Quince Girl.

2) Long Beach Museum of Art

What can be better than dancing to Calvin Harris’ “Summer” under the stars, right next to the ocean?! Stun your guests with a Long Beach banquet hall with a breath-taking view of the ocean as they dance the night away during your Quince party. The Long Beach Museum of Art sits right alongside the ocean and allows its patrons to host events on the lawn in between the Museum pavilion and the Historic Elizabeth Milbank Anderson House. Catering for the venue is provided by the museum’s in-house restaurant, Claire’s Café and Restaurant.

3) Hotel Maya, a Long Beach banquet hall

If you want to pay homage to your Latin American roots at your Quince party, then Hotel Maya could be the ideal Long Beach banquet hall. Long Beach’s harbor is flanked by the tropical setting of the Hotel Maya, with its 400 palm trees, cabana-style seating and modern, bright architecture. You will think you’ve stepped off the plane in Cozumel, Mexico, but you really are stepping into a fairytale Quince venue!

4) The Grand

The Grand event center allows you to customize your Quince venue size and atmosphere much like you would a jigsaw puzzle. This Long Beach banquet hall sits on four acres and has multiple styles of banquet halls for a reception gathering that is large or small. Two courtyards are also on the property, in case you’re looking for an outdoor garden-style celebration.

5) Don the Beachcomber

Alohhaa to a tropical Quince venue right in the heart of Huntington Beach! Alright, although this Hawaiian-themed restaurant is actually just a small drive south of Long Beach, it instantly takes your breath away with its island charm, including straw-hut ceilings, palm trees surrounding a waterfall, bamboo accents, wood chairs and more. With this type of décor, you can let your venue do the talking and have a stress-free decoration process. So get those hula skirts out and ditch the tiara for a regal crown of fresh orchids, lilies, and plumerias.
